Talking about yesterday Ministerial Forum, MM Lee still retain his sharp wits and retort judging from the way he answered the many questions posed by 'strangely' foreigners in NTU.



Foreigners seem to see MM Lee in a different light, with quite a couple mentioning it is his/her honor to be speaking to our esteemed leader etc and asking questions that hold close of their heart.However, MM Lee kept posing questions about where they came from and where did they learn their English followed by 'CONGRATULATIONS! you speak good English.' Perhaps I might be too sensitive but I couldn't help but sniff a thin veil of cynicism in his questioning and replies but he did answer the questions well enough so they should have no complain.

I am not entirely satisfied regarding the Q&A session because the questions (asked by the foreigners who strangely were selected by the moderator quite often) were essentially too diversified and more of the global issue rather than issue that are close to our heart. e.g. CPF rates change, increment of retirement ages, gay rights ( he did touch on that a little), 4th University in Singapore.

However there were some interesting questions enough e.g. what will MM Lee study in NTU if suppose he could turn back time and choose his field of study which he replied: Economics, Mathematics or Psychology. No more lawyer for him even though the salary earn good pay but it do not bring him enough satisfactions.

Overall, I think MM Lee is still able to offer sound advices on the global political and economics issue but he seems to have problems grappling with the fast pace of technological advances and arty farty issues..which is pretty reasonable for his age. The things he touched on offered another perspectives on the current 'Economic' boom/ gloom the world is encountering. His mind is clear, his wits is sharp and he is still able to shoot you up down left right easily if you try something funny.
